Yves Tumor at HISTORY | Photo Gallery

On May 9th, Yves Tumor stormed History in Toronto with their distinct blend of glam rock, post-punk and industrial grunge as part of the "To Spite or Not to Spite" North American tour. They hyped up the ocean of fans with songs like "God is a Circle", "Gospel for a New Century ' and "Heaven Surrounds Us Like a Hood".


Their live rendition of "Operator" was a favourite as the entire audience erupted with a chorus of "Be aggressive!" on top of the driving bass stylings of bassist Gina Ramirez. The band, most notably guitarist Chris Greatti, brought an explosive aura to the stage, especially during their electrifying encore.


Yves Tumor was also supported by indie rock band Pretty Sick and Calfornia-based electronic duo NATION.
